3. Design Features
The obverse of the coin features the year "1968" along with the inscription "ΚΩΝΣΤΑΝΤΙΝΟΣ ΒΑΣΙΛΕΥΣ ΤΩΝ ΕΛΛΗΝΩΝ" (Constantine II King of the Hellenes), showcasing a portrait of King Constantine II. On the reverse, "10 ΔΡΑΧΜΑΙ" (10 drachmas) is inscribed above the depiction of the "ΒΑΣΙΛΕΙΟΝ ΤΗΣ ΕΛΛΑΔΟΣ" (Kingdom of Greece).
4. Technical Specifications
This coin has a weight of 10.05g and a diameter of 30.00mm, making it substantial in size and weight. The composition of copper-nickel adds durability and a distinctive appearance to the coin. These technical specifications contribute to the overall appeal of the Greece 10 drachmas 1968 coin.
